Nestled within the stunning Andes Mountains of northern Peru, the Alto Mayo Protected Rainforest is a haven for biodiversity. In 2012, the Alto Mayo Co-op emerged from the aspirations of 12 enterprising young men and 3 young women. Their shared vision aimed not only at crafting exceptional coffee but also at championing environmental preservation and embracing a direct-to-market approach, eliminating the need for intermediaries in the coffee production process.
What began as a modest cooperative has blossomed into a formidable force, with 943 families participating in this collaborative venture. These families are dispersed across 45 distinct production areas within the Alto Mayo region, contributing to a rich tapestry of community-driven coffee cultivation.
This specific coffee undergoes a unique decaffeination process known as the Swiss Water Process. Developed in Switzerland in 1933, this method stands out for its commitment to environmental consciousness. The beans are immersed in hot water for an extended period, a process that efficiently removes caffeine. The innovation lies in the reuse of the water – transformed into steam to complete the decaffeination without resorting to any organic solvents.
